$\int \frac{\cos 2 x-\cos 2 \theta}{\cos x-\cos \theta} d x$ is equal to
A
$2(\sin x+x \cos \theta)+C$.
B
$2(\sin x-x \cos \theta)+C$
C
$2(\sin x+2 x \cos \theta)+C$
D
$2(\sin x-2 x \cos \theta)+C$
